Features

  • Up to 95% Efficiency
  • Output Current for DCDC Converters 2 × 0.6A
  • Two Selectable Fixed Output Voltages 1.0 V/1.2 V for DCDC2
  • VIN Range for DCDC Converters From 2.5 V to 6 V
  • 2.25 MHz Fixed Frequency Operation
  • Power Save Mode at Light Load Current
  • 180° Out of Phase Operation
  • Output Voltage Accuracy in PWM Mode ±1%
  • Low Ripple PFM Mode
  • Total Typ. 32 µA Quiescent Current for Both DCDC Converters
  • 100% Duty Cycle for Lowest Dropout
  • 2 General Purpose 400 mA- High PSRR LDOs
  • 2 General Purpose 200 mA- High PSRR LDOs
  • VIN Range for LDOs from 1.5 V to 6.5 V
  • Digital Voltage Selection for the LDOs
  • I2C Compatible Interface
  • Available in a 4 mm × 4 mm 32-Pin QFN Package

Description

The TPS65055 is an integrated Power Management IC for applications powered by one Li-Ion or Li-Polymer cell, which require multiple power rails.

The TPS65055 provides two highly efficient,
2.25 MHz step-down converters targeted at providing the core voltage and I/O voltage in a processor-based system. Both step-down converters enter a low power mode at light load for maximum efficiency across the widest possible range of load currents.

For low noise applications the device can be forced into fixed frequency PWM mode using the I2C compatible interface. In shutdown mode, current consumption is reduced to less than 1 µA.

The device allows the use of small inductors and capacitors to achieve a small solution size.
